What is the test for starch?
Add iodine then look to see if colour has changed from brown/ orange is blue/ black it means starch is present
Benedict’s test for reducing sugars
Benedict’s regent is added (starts blue) then boil - if a reducing sugar is present it will turn red
Benedict’s test for non reducing sugars
Boil sample of benedict's solution Boil a fresh sample with dilute acid Neutralise with alkalis Now redo the benedict's test If it turns red a non reducing sugar was present in the first step
